How to fill out the NCMEA Choral Section Adjudicator:

01
Start by reviewing the guidelines and requirements provided by NCMEA for the choral section adjudicator. Familiarize yourself with the specific criteria and expectations for evaluating performances.
02
Ensure that you have the necessary forms and documents required for the adjudication process. This may include score sheets, evaluation rubrics, and feedback forms.
03
Familiarize yourself with the performance repertoire. Listen to or read through the pieces that will be performed by the choral groups you'll be adjudicating. This will help you make more informed assessments and provide valuable feedback.
04
Arrive at the designated location on time and prepared to evaluate multiple choral groups. It is important to be organized and have a clear plan for documenting your evaluations.
05
During the performance, take detailed notes on each group's strengths and weaknesses. This may include aspects such as tone quality, intonation, diction, musicality, and overall interpretation.
06
Use the provided score sheets or evaluation rubrics to assign scores or ratings to each performance category. Take into account both the group's technical proficiency and their artistic expression.
07
After each performance, provide constructive feedback to the group. This may be done verbally or through written comments on feedback forms. Focus on highlighting their strengths and offering suggestions for improvement.
08
Complete all necessary paperwork and documentation required by NCMEA. Make sure your evaluations are clear, concise, and accurately reflect your observations.
09
Submit your evaluations and any other required forms to the designated individuals or committees as instructed by NCMEA.
10
Reflect on the adjudication experience and consider any areas where you could enhance your own knowledge or skills as a choral section adjudicator.
